Va. Code § 6.2-1623: Notice of proposed suspension or revocation

The Commission may not revoke or suspend the license of any licensee upon any of the grounds set forth in § 6.2-1619 until it has given the mortgage lender or mortgage broker (i) 21 days' notice in writing of the reasons for the proposed revocation or suspension and (ii) an opportunity to introduce evidence and be heard. The notice shall be sent by certified mail to the principal place of business of such licensee and shall state with particularity the grounds for the contemplated action. Within 14 days of mailing the notice, the licensee named therein may file with the clerk of the Commission a written request for a hearing. If a hearing is requested, the Commission shall not suspend or revoke the license except based upon findings made at such hearing. The hearing shall be conducted in accordance with the provisions of Title 12.1.1987, c. 596, § 6.1-427; 2010, c. 794.
